Types of Forestry Machines: Matching to the Task

Each forestry machine is built for a specific job, so start by identifying what you need to accomplish.

For Harvesting and Moving Timber

Log harvesters are the workhorses of timber harvesting. They cut down trees, trim branches, and cut logs to precise lengths—all in one pass. Equipped with powerful chainsaws et systèmes hydrauliques, they handle even large hardwoods with ease.
Skidders come next, moving cut logs from the forest to a collection point. They use cables or grapples to drag logs over rough terrain, avec tracks (instead of wheels) for better traction in muddy or steep areas. Forwarders are similar but carry logs off the ground, protecting soil and minimizing damage to remaining trees—ideal for forest thinning where you want to preserve young growth.

For Clearing and Processing

Tree shears (mounted on excavators or tractors) cut through tree trunks up to several feet in diameter, perfect for land clearing or removing damaged trees. Brush cutters tackle smaller vegetation, trimming bushes and saplings to create firebreaks or prepare land for planting.
Wood chippers turn branches and small logs into wood chips, which can be used for mulch or biomass fuel. They’re essential for wood processing after harvesting. Mulchers take this further, grinding stumps and thick brush into fine mulch that enriches the soil—great for reforestation prep.

For Planting and Maintenance

Tree planters automate the tedious work of planting seedlings. They dig holes, place saplings, and pack soil—speeding up reforestation projets. Some models can plant hundreds of trees per hour, a huge upgrade from hand planting.
Pruners trim branches from living trees, improving forest health and reducing fire risks by removing dead wood. They’re also used in urban forestry to keep street trees safe and attractive. Firefighting equipment like forest fire trucks and water pumps are critical for fire prevention and fighting wildfires, protecting both forests and nearby communities.

Composants clés: How Forestry Machines Work

Understanding the parts of your machine helps with operation, entretien, et dépannage:
  • Blades et chainsaws do the cutting—sharp, durable blades are essential for efficiency and safety. Log harvesters et pruners rely on these to make clean cuts.
  • Systèmes hydrauliques power movements like lifting booms or closing grapples. They’re the muscle behind tree shears et skidders, allowing precise control even with heavy loads.
  • Engines (often diesel) provide power. Larger machines like log harvesters need high-horsepower engines to handle tough tasks, while smaller brush cutters can use smaller engines for better fuel efficiency.
  • Wheels or tracks determine where the machine can go. Tracks are better for steep, uneven terrain (common in forests), alors que roues work well on flat, graded surfaces like forest roads.
  • Control panels let operators adjust settings—from the speed of a wood chipper to the angle of a boom. Modern machines may include capteurs that alert operators to issues like low oil pressure or hydraulic leaks.
  • Safety devices like roll cages, seatbelts, and emergency stop buttons protect operators. Forestry work is dangerous, so these features are non-negotiable.

Applications: Where Forestry Machines Shine

Forestry machines adapt to a range of environments and goals, from commercial logging to conservation.
  • Timber harvesting relies on log harvesters, skidders, et forwarders to efficiently collect logs while minimizing environmental impact. Modern machines are designed to leave as little trace as possible, protecting soil and waterways.
  • Forest thinning uses skidders et pruners to remove select trees, allowing remaining ones to grow stronger. This improves forest health and reduces wildfire risks by creating space between trees.
  • Reforestation et tree planting projects depend on tree planters to replace harvested trees, ensuring sustainable forestry. Some machines even plant native species tailored to the local ecosystem.
  • Land clearing for roads, agriculture, or development uses tree shears, brush cutters, et mulchers to prepare land efficiently. Road building in forests also uses specialized machines to create access paths for harvesting and maintenance.
  • Urban forestry uses smaller, more maneuverable machines like pruners and compact tree shears to care for trees in cities and towns, balancing development with green spaces.

Operating Forestry Machines: Safety and Efficiency

Forestry work is high-risk, so proper operation is critical for both safety and results.

Training and Safety First

Operator training is non-negotiable. Forestry machines are complex and powerful—even experienced equipment operators need specific training to use them safely. Courses cover everything from hydraulic system basics to emergency procedures.
Follow safety protocols rigorously: wear protective gear (hard hats, steel-toe boots, visibility vests), inspect machines before use, and never operate equipment alone in remote areas. Safety devices like rollover protection structures (ROPS) and seatbelts must be used at all times.

Calibration and Maintenance

Equipment calibration ensures your machine works as intended. Par exemple, tree planters need adjustments to plant seedlings at the right depth, et wood chippers require proper settings to produce consistent chip sizes.
Stick to a maintenance schedule: check engines for oil and fuel levels, inspect systèmes hydrauliques for leaks, and sharpen blades et chainsaws régulièrement. Neglecting maintenance leads to breakdowns, costly repairs, and safety risks.

Environmental Considerations

Minimize your impact on forests. Use forwarders instead of skidders when possible to reduce soil compaction. Avoid operating in wetlands or near streams, and follow regulations for wildlife habitat management—many forests are home to endangered species. Noise control est également important, especially in urban forestry or near residential areas.

FAQ

  1. What’s the difference between a skidder and a forwarder?
Skidders drag logs along the ground, which is efficient but can disturb soil. Forwarders carry logs on a platform, keeping them off the ground—better for protecting soil and young trees, making them ideal for forest thinning.
  1. How do I maintain a chainsaw on a log harvester?
Clean the chain after each use, sharpen teeth regularly, and check for wear. Lubricate the chain and bar to prevent overheating. Follow the maintenance schedule in your machine’s manual to avoid breakdowns during busy harvesting seasons.
  1. Can tree planters handle different types of seedlings?
Oui, most tree planters are adjustable to accommodate different seedling sizes and soil types. You can adjust hole depth and soil packing pressure to match the needs of pine, oak, or other tree species.
